基于STM32的工业级电导率测量仪设计与实现
版权申诉
5星 · 超过95%的资源 153 浏览量
更新于2024-10-15
5
收藏 72.96MB ZIP 举报
资源摘要信息:"本资源主要介绍了基于STM32单片机开发的一款电导率测量仪的设计和实现过程。电导率测量仪被广泛应用于化学分析、环境监测、工业过程控制等领域,用于检测溶液中离子的导电能力。本项目由项目情景、预期目标、具体行动和项目成果四个部分构成,旨在设计并实现一款功能完备、成本较低的工业级电导率测量仪。
硬件方面:
1. 设计正弦波发生模块,用于驱动电导率传感器,获取准确的电导率数据。
2. 设计滤波模块,对正弦波模块产生的信号进行处理,以提高数据精度。
3. 设计放大处理模块,以增强电导率传感器传回的信号,满足模数转换器(ADC)的要求。
4. 设计电压转置模块,为放大电路的芯片提供所需的负电源。
软件方面:
1. 编写正弦波发生芯片的驱动程序,确保电导率传感器正常工作。
2. 编写温度传感器的驱动程序,同步采集温度数据,用于电导率数据的校准。
3. 编写ADC程序,将模拟信号转换为数字信号,以便于处理和显示。
4. 编写LCD屏驱动程序,实现实验数据的直观显示。
5. 编写触摸屏驱动程序,方便用户通过触摸操作设备,实现人机交互。
6. 编写SD卡驱动程序,将实验数据保存于SD卡中,便于数据的后续处理和分析。
7. 编写串口打印程序,将数据通过串口发送,实现数据的远程传输。
该项目的软件部分包括了基于STM32F429芯片的源代码,项目代码经过测试运行成功,功能正常。该资源适合计算机相关专业的学生、老师以及企业员工下载学习,同时也适合初学者学习进阶。项目完成后,可以用于毕设、课程设计、作业等,具有较高的实用价值和学习价值。
STM32微控制器系列由STMicroelectronics生产,因其高性能、低成本、低功耗以及丰富的外设和扩展性而广泛应用于嵌入式系统开发。STM32F429属于STM32F4系列,具有高性能的Cortex-M4处理器核心,支持浮点运算,具有高达180MHz的主频,丰富的外设接口,包括ADC、DAC、USART等,使得开发高性能和高精度的测量仪器成为可能。
该资源中还包含了项目代码的压缩包文件,用户下载后应首先阅读README.md文件,以确保正确理解和使用资源。特别提醒,所有内容仅供学习参考,切勿用于商业用途。"
关键词:STM32, 电导率测量仪, 源代码, STM32F429, 正弦波发生模块, 滤波模块, 放大处理模块, 电压转置模块, ADC, LCD驱动, 触摸屏驱动, SD卡驱动, 串口打印程序, 硬件设计, 软件开发, 电子信息, 传感器技术, 项目学习, 非商业使用
2024-03-29 上传
2022-05-06 上传
2024-10-29 上传
2024-03-11 上传
点击了解资源详情
2021-10-16 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
奋斗奋斗再奋斗的ajie
- 粉丝: 1195
- 资源: 2908
最新资源
- Java集合ArrayList实现字符串管理及效果展示
- 实现2D3D相机拾取射线的关键技术
- LiveLy-公寓管理门户:创新体验与技术实现
- 易语言打造的快捷禁止程序运行小工具
- Microgateway核心:实现配置和插件的主端口转发
- 掌握Java基本操作:增删查改入门代码详解
- Apache Tomcat 7.0.109 Windows版下载指南
- Qt实现文件系统浏览器界面设计与功能开发
- ReactJS新手实验:搭建与运行教程
- 探索生成艺术:几个月创意Processing实验
- Django框架下Cisco IOx平台实战开发案例源码解析
- 在Linux环境下配置Java版VTK开发环境
- 29街网上城市公司网站系统v1.0:企业建站全面解决方案
- WordPress CMB2插件的Suggest字段类型使用教程
- TCP协议实现的Java桌面聊天客户端应用
- ANR-WatchDog: 检测Android应用无响应并报告异常